This is the year of the girl in Lane County.
This is the time for putting our feet down, our heads up and our shoulders to the wheel to see that girls at risk in our community get the services they need and deserve.The lack of social services from drug and alcohol treatment to shelter and mental health counseling means that girls living on the edge are denied help that is available to boys. One would think that sort of gender discrimination went out in the 60s but, in the name of budget cuts, its happening today.
As women, we find the situation appalling, and unacceptable. As mothers and daughters, it breaks our hearts. As citizens and voters, we are organizing to do something about it.
Investing in girls now just makes common sense: Girls are our future mothers. We need to take care of them so they can take care of the next generation of children.
